DEERFIELD Debate volleyed back and forth at Wednesday’s Zoning Board of Appeals meeting, and members ultimately voted to adjourn until next month to see if new information materializes in Dollar General’s quest to build a store at the corner of Mill Village Road and Routes 5 and 10.
The board met via the online conferencing platform Zoom for 2½ hours and discussed everything from the positive and negative aspects of having a Dollar General to the board’s civic duty. Members adjourned shortly before 8:30 p.m. and agreed to meet at 6 p.m. on Jan. 14.
